Netanyahu says focus on hostages after Sinwar death
Israel’s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u has spoken, following the killing of Hamas leader Yahya Sinwar.
Sinwar, who topped Israel’s most-wanted list, was a key figure believed to have been behind the 7 October attacks.
Netanyahu claims the Hamas leader was “eliminated while fleeing in panic” from Israeli soldiers.
